In the waning days of winter all I really want to find is a fresh vegetable, somewhere, anywhere. Well, I found them last night at Cobble. Every course featured local root vegetables, each perfectly balanced. I had to stop myself from eating too much, knowing there was even more to come. Parsnip hummus!? So creative. The pasta en brodo was a favorite- so fresh and lemony, perfectly cheesy and warming. The thinly sliced Berkshire porchetta was melt-in-your-mouth divine. What surprised me the most, however, was dessert. I 'm really not one for sweets, but that Carrot Cake Twinkie was a bite to behold. Score a table if you can! What a fantastic night.
